My name is Michael Wallace. I am the Regional Manager for Boosey & Hawkes
Musical Instruments, Inc. for California and Nevada. We are the makers and
distributors of the Buffet clarinets. It has been brought to my attention
that a shop in Los Angeles (a former Buffet dealer) has purchased some "second
hand" clarinets to sell as new. These clarinets were purchased gray-market
from another country. That is, around the US distribution. As a result,
these instruments have not received our "Platinum Service". They have not
been inspected by Francois Kloc and his crew. They will not have a valid
warranty here in the US. Boosey & Hawkes Musical Instruments, Inc. (USA) will
not guarantee the gray-marketed clarinets (and low C bass clarinets) against
CRACKING OR ANYTHING ELSE. We at Boosey & Hawkes are very proud of our Buffet
clarinets and we want you, the player, to enjoy the wonderful experince of
knowing that you have purchased the very best clarinet for you. I feel it is
my duty to warn you. Beware and buy your Buffet from an AUTHORIZED BOOSEY &
HAWKES DEALER IN YOUR AREA.
